Building materials can easily be stored between floor joists or ceiling rafters. Pieces of molding that are long, and materials that are larger than that can be placed in this area with minimal effort. Just put some furring strips on the floor joists so that the materials can be stored.

Always turn off the main water supply before you mess with plumbing. Whenever your project involves the water supply or pipes, it’s important to find the shutoff valve and turn the water off before starting work. This will make sure you don’t flood your house.

Use baby food jars for organizing your office. Just use a little super glue to attach the lids under a wall shelf. Put smaller items in the jars, including parts, nails and screws. Then twist the jars back into place under the shelf. You’ll maximize the use of the shelf and get a second use out of all those jars.

When preparing to install kitchen cabinets, you should draw a horizontal bench-mark line all around your kitchen’s perimeter. This serves as a reference for measuring the proper placement for the cabinetry. Begin your bench mark line equidistant to the highest point on the floor.

Prior to applying paint over top of glossy finish paint, coat it with quality primer. The primer will make the paint stick to the wall right away and keep it from peeling. If you are going from a dark to light color, primer is especially important.

Use wallpaper and varnish to make a backsplash in your kitchen. Use a wallpaper you like. Measure the wall space twice and cut the paper a little larger than you need. Add the paste to the wall and let it set until it gets tacky. Then place the wallpaper and utilize a squeegee to remove any bubbles that appear. Finally, cut the edges to make it fit perfectly. Apply your varnish with a brush. As soon as it’s dry, your attractive, cost-effective back-splash is complete.
